How to Stay Safe While Riding Your Electric Scooter

Using an electric scooter demands caution and attentiveness to guarantee safety on crowded city streets. Scooter users should always wear a helmet, as this notably reduces the risk of head injuries in case of accidents. It is crucial to familiarize oneself with local traffic laws, as regulations can change significantly by city. Maintaining a safe speed and maintaining adequate space from vehicles and pedestrians promotes overall safety.

Furthermore, riders must stay aware of potential hazards such as potholes, debris, and sudden obstacles. Making use of hand signals when changing direction or halting can also communicate intentions to others on the road. Riding at night requires reflective equipment or lights to boost visibility. Ultimately, eliminating distractions such as phones fosters more focused riding. By complying with these safety practices, e-scooter riders can benefit from a more secure and responsible journey as they travel through urban landscapes.

How Do Electric Scooters Compare to Bikes in Urban Settings?

Electric scooters generally offer faster, more compact transportation than bikes, perfect for brief journeys. However, bikes provide greater physical activity and stability. In the end, the decision relies on individual preferences and specific urban environments.

What Are the Costs of Owning an Electric Scooter?

Purchasing an electric scooter includes initial purchase costs, upkeep costs, insurance fees, and possible recharging expenses. Furthermore, users may face storage charges and demand supplementary gear, all contributing to the overall financial commitment of owning one.

Are Electric Scooters Appropriate for Every Age Group?

Electric scooters tend to be well-suited for riders of all ages, so long as users comply with proper safety recommendations. However, younger children may require supervision, while older adults should consider their physical capabilities and comfort with balancing and maneuvering.

How Do Weather Conditions Affect Electric Scooter Usage?

Weather plays a significant role in how electric scooters are used. Precipitation, snowfall, and extreme temperatures prevent riders from venturing out owing to safety issues and discomfort, while pleasant, dry conditions fosters greater frequency of use, improving the overall riding experience and accessibility.

Which Regulations Control Electric Scooter Riding in Urban Areas?

Guidelines controlling e-scooter use within city limits typically consist of helmet requirements, insurance mandates, speed limits, age restrictions, and designated parking areas. These policies work to promote safer travel, alleviate urban congestion, and embed scooters within established transportation networks.
